The Underlying Drivers of Online High School Popularity
- The Digital Revolution and Infrastructure Growth: The unstoppable expansion of the internet and digital technology has dismantled many traditional educational barriers. Broadband connectivity, smartphones, and user-friendly learning platforms have made online education accessible and attractive to a broad demographic. As a result, numerous private entities and well-established educational institutions are now offering online high school programs to capitalize on this growth.
- Economic Factors and Cost-Effectiveness: One of the strongest attractions of online high schools is affordability. Conventional schooling often involves hefty tuition fees, commuting costs, and supplementary expenses. Online schools, on the other hand, typically charge lower fees due to reduced infrastructure costs and fewer administrative burdens. For parents and students seeking economical options without compromising on the quality of education, online high schools present an appealing alternative.
- Flexibility and Convenience: Online high schools provide unparalleled flexibility—students can attend classes from anywhere, at any time. This flexibility caters to diverse needs, including students who are engaged in professional careers, athletes, artists, or those with health issues preventing regular attendance. The ability to balance education with personal responsibilities has made online education particularly popular among non-traditional students.
- Recognition and Certification: A significant concern for online students is the acknowledgment of their qualifications. Many online high school diplomas are recognized by educational authorities, ensuring that students can pursue higher education or vocational training without hurdles. This recognition has helped legitimize online high schools and foster trust among prospective students and parents.
- Innovative Curriculum and Courses: Online high schools often offer cutting-edge, professionally designed curricula that may be more attractive and relevant than traditional offerings. These institutions frequently include specialized courses, vocational training, advanced placement options, and skill-based modules that prepare students effectively for modern job markets. Such innovation draws students seeking personalized, engaging educational experiences beyond conventional systems.
Benefits for Students and Society
- Accessibility to Diversified Learning Opportunities: Online high schools break geographical barriers, providing access to quality education to students in remote or underserved areas. This democratization of education ensures that geographic and socio-economic disadvantages become less relevant in accessing quality secondary education.
- Preparation for a Digital Future: As digital literacy becomes essential, online learning equips students with vital skills such as self-motivation, digital proficiency, and independent study habits. These competencies are increasingly sought after in the contemporary world, making online high school graduates better prepared for higher studies and careers.
- Alleviation of Traditional School Congestion: Overcrowded classrooms, strained resources, and staffing shortages have long plagued traditional schools. Online high schools provide a relief valve, reducing congestion and enabling traditional schools to focus more on personal interaction and specialized teaching.
- Variety and Personalization: Many online platforms utilize adaptive learning technologies, allowing students to learn at their own pace and style. This customization fosters better understanding, improved retention, and higher engagement, leading to more successful educational outcomes.
Addressing Quality and Perception Challenges
While the rapid growth of online high schools is promising, it has also sparked debates regarding quality and standards. Critics often point out that some online institutions lack the rigorous oversight or qualified faculty found in traditional schools. This disparity results in variable quality, which can undermine trust in online diplomas.
However, reputable online high school providers, backed by established educational organizations and universities, maintain rigorous standards. They invest in professional faculty, advanced learning technologies, and comprehensive accreditation processes to ensure quality and consistency. Many also incorporate interactive elements, live lessons, and counseling services to mirror traditional classroom engagement.
The perception issues are gradually being addressed as more recognized institutions venture into online education, bringing credibility and higher standards to the sector. For students and parents concerned about quality, selecting programs affiliated with reputable educational bodies can mitigate fears and ensure valuable learning experiences.
